A representation of the execution of Lord Lovat
[1747]
185 x 115 mm, trimmed within plate mark; design: 170 x 88 mm
Peel 0375
Notes
Key engraved under design reads: "A. The Scaffold. B. Lord Lovat's head on the Block. C. Cloth to receive the Head. D. The Executioner with the Axe. E. The Coffin. F. The House from which he came on the Scaffold".
